Of practical day-to-day positive impacts you can have, one of the greatest is in simply looking out for "good"* labels on foods and other consumer goods.
And if you can't see a label, ask the store's staff.
You would be amazed, but in simply asking if a store stocks responsibly produced this-that-or-the-other, you are creating a perceived demand.
And you know what the world's biggest and most influential businesses love to do? (The same businesses that can have HUGE impacts on the environment and our ecological debt.)
They love to satisfy our demands... because they want us to buy their products.
So even though your one request may only be a whisper in the global marketplace - the fact is that as more and more of us do the same as you - your whisper will join our whispers and emerge as a murmur. An undercurrent. A trend.
And these companies are no fools – they are constantly looking for ways to satisfy us – they look out for trends - and they will eventually listen.
